Ar2797 , ar2798 , ar2799 wl 23/01/2021

I managed to catch these around 9.30 am before the seeing went bad. I used my 180 Maksutov , Baader ND3.8 Astrosolar film, IRcut and Solar continuum filter, camera used was a ASI120mm.
